"I recently went on a Bear Viewing Fly Out Trip with Alaska West Air to Crescent Lake in the Lake Clark National Park. Our guide was named Jake and he was the BEST guide of all time. Our group was 4 women and 2 kids (5 & 8) and we had the best time. Jake was amazing with the kids - I think he made this trip the best day of these kids lives. Bring lots of layers, water, and snacks - it was windy the day we went and it got cold if you weren't in the sun. They have hip waiters that you can borrow that I'd absolutely recommend doing that even though you are in a boat or on the beach most of the day. They also had kid's life jackets to borrow and a couple of kid hip waiters. We saw a sow and her new cub and 2 juvenile bears during our trip and our guide let us fish a little bit. You can do both bear viewing and fishing (it's the same price) but the guides like to know ahead of time. I had gone to Wolverine Creek earlier that week and must say, Lake Crescent is a much better view and is probably one of the most beautiful places I've ever been. The plane ride was a little bit bumpy due to wind, but it wasn't too bad once you got higher in elevation and I never felt unsafe once. These pilots fly these same routes day in and day out 4+ times a day, so it was pretty easy to trust them and I'm not the world's greatest flyer. I would absolutely go back to Crescent Lake with Alaska West Air."
